Latest revision as of 12:29, 10 December 2023

Graanonymous

The Info Wars began on January 17th, 2016, when Xiaoguard and Constantine created a guild named Graanonymous using two alternate accounts, both named Graanon. Graanonymous was founded in the immediate aftermath of the end of the Kingdom of Reuss, when Xiaoguard took control of Lord Caen's account and convinced Constantine to abdicate from Reuss. The purpose of Graanonymous was to collect, store, and trade information. While Graanonymous only lasted a few days, it left plenty of chaos in its wake. They caused several players to quit the game, both temporarily and permanently, using various aggressive tactics. They staged various in-game demonstrations to sow paranoia in the community. They "doxxed" Arno and published other information on the Graanonymous website. Xiaoguard and Constantine later published an apology for the ordeal. Graanonymous marked the beginning of the popularization of collecting and storing personal information on players. The military community's population suffered greatly for some time due to the atmosphere that the Info Wars had created, and blackmail became commonplace. Collecting and making use of personal information eventually came to be widely looked down upon, and it is no longer seen as frequently as it was during this period. Some guilds, including Constantine's Sarovia, have since put forward legislation to attempt to place a community-wide ban on the collection and use of personal information.
